public static string ToHexString(this byte[] bytes, bool hexPrefix = false) { return(HexUtility.GetHexFromBytes(bytes, hexPrefix: hexPrefix)); }
public static string ToHexString(this IEnumerable <byte> bytes, bool hexPrefix = false) { return(HexUtility.GetHexFromBytes(bytes.ToArray(), hexPrefix: hexPrefix)); }
public static string ToHexString(this Memory <byte> bytes, bool hexPrefix = false) { return(HexUtility.GetHexFromBytes(bytes.Span, hexPrefix: hexPrefix)); }
public static string ToHexString(this ReadOnlySpan <byte> bytes, bool hexPrefix = false) { return(HexUtility.GetHexFromBytes(bytes, hexPrefix: hexPrefix)); }
public static ReadOnlySpan <byte> HexToReadOnlySpan(this string hexString) { return(HexUtility.HexToBytes(hexString)); }
public static byte[] HexToBytes(this string hexString) { return(HexUtility.HexToBytes(hexString)); }
public static ReadOnlyMemory <byte> HexToReadOnlyMemory(this string hexString) { return(HexUtility.HexToMemory(hexString)); }